开发套件与开发板的区别及其应用
开发套件与开发板都是用于软件和硬件开发的重要工具,但它们在设计目的、功能复杂度以及使用场景上有所不同。开发板通常指的是一个集成了一定硬件组件的电路板,如处理器、存储器、输入输出接口等,它是用来进行特定硬件平台上的编程和测试的基础工具。开发板往往面向特定的应用场景或技术栈,例如Arduino和Raspberry Pi,它们各自拥有广泛的社区支持和丰富的扩展模块。
相比之下,开发套件则更加全面,它不仅包含了开发板所具备的基本硬件组件,还可能包括额外的软件开发工具、文档、示例代码、调试器以及其他辅助设备。开发套件的设计目的是为了帮助开发者更快地开始项目开发,降低入门门槛,并加速产品原型到最终产品的转化过程。因此,开发套件往往针对特定的应用领域或项目需求进行优化配置,比如智能手机开发套件、物联网开发套件等。通过选择合适的开发套件或开发板,开发者能够更高效地实现创意和技术愿景。